Lila Sciences is seeking a Computational Scientist I/II, Soft Matter Formulations , Solids and Melts to develop models, tools, and workflows that accelerate discovery across polymeric and soft material systems. This role focuses on solids and viscoelastic materials, including polymers and elastomers, gels, hot-melt adhesives, composites, powders, films, semi-solids, and crystalline or amorphous solids.
You will bring domain expertise in polymer science, soft matter physics, rheology, solid materials, formulation science, or a closely related area, and apply machine learning methods to connect formulation choices, processing history, structure, morphology, and end-use performance. The work spans melt processing, mechanical performance, thermal transitions, processing windows, crystallinity, cross-link density, cure kinetics, and formulation-to-processing-to-property relationships.
This is a hands‑on scientific ML role for someone who can bridge domain context and computational execution. You will develop structure-property models for solid and viscoelastic materials, build cure- and processing‑aware representations, incorporate molecular or polymer descriptors and simulation constraints, and design active learning workflows tied to the throughput of the physical formulation workcell.
